Where is Embassy of Georgia?
Where is Embassy of Georgia located?
Embassy of Georgia, Embassy of Georgia, Great Britain (approx. 51.5°, -0.211°)
Where is Embassy of Georgia on the map?
{"latitude":51.5,"longitude":-0.211,"title":"Embassy of Georgia"}